Collector Insights

Manectric-EX is a Pokémon card with 170 HP, featuring two distinct attacks. The first attack, Overrun, requires one Colorless Energy and deals 20 damage to a single Benched Pokémon, bypassing Weakness and Resistance for that target. The second attack, Assault Laser, costs one Lightning and one Colorless Energy, dealing 60+ damage if the opponent’s Active Pokémon has a Pokémon Tool attached. The card’s design is attributed to artist Eske Yoshinob and was released as part of the M Master Deck Build Box Speed Style set on August 7, 2015. It belongs to the Pokémon supertype and carries the number 13 in its set. The card’s abilities emphasize direct damage and conditional bonuses, reflecting its strategic versatility.
